Do not follow that guide if you have a D0 stepping cpu. The older C0 steppings required more voltage. If you use those voltages it could fry your chip.

If you're using VT then ok. I thought you may have had it enabled by mistake. I don't know what affect if any it would have on an OC. I would disable it while your working to find your stable OC then re-enable it later. Best way to OC is by going up in increments and testing in between. Start fairly easy. Set your bclk to 181 with a multi of 20 for a 3.6ghz OC. If you're not using vdroop, set vcore to 1.30 and VTT to +100mv and dim voltage to mfg'r spec. All other on auto. Your pic shows ram specs set? If that's the case, leave as is. Don't worry about your ram clock speed yet. Now while monitoring CPU temps with Real temp, run a stress test for 10 min or so. Let's see how that goes. If all is good, up your bclk by 5 & test again. Once you bsod, note the code so we get an idea of what voltage to tweak. We'll start with this until we get stable at a 201 bclk. Just watch your CPU temps.
